Lite Brite Night

The University Place Mall in Provo, Utah holds one of the best Christmas Secrets of all time. You have to search for this secret, and its only found after walking all the way through the mall. You will see Santa’s workshop half way through the mall, which is super fun, but don’t stop there! You will pass Christmas concerts playing, but that still isn’t your final destination. Once you have hit the end of the mall, go outside and you have found it!

Lite Brite Night is exactly as it sounds. It is a giant outdoors Lite Brite toy for all ages to come and play. The huge toy is over 6 feet tall and it actually works! On the cement floor, is a big box full of the Lite Brite kegs, except massive sized! The Lite Brite kegs are about as big as a child’s hand. They are light-weight and very colorful. After completing a design with the Lite Brite pegs, there are cookies and hot chocolate to enjoy for free!

This is not all! All around the outdoors park area in the middle of the mall, there are dozens of Christmas trees all lit up! You can walk into the center of the trees and witness the lights changing colors. Some trees are miniature sized, and are good for children to walk into, and others are over 8 feet tall. In the center of the park area, is the biggest Christmas tree of all! It as over 15 feet high and the lights change colors and dance to the music playing all around.

Another cool thing to do, is to create light up colorful igloos. There are huge pieces of shapes all around the park to build a big colorful igloo. Most of the shapes are quarts of a circle. They change colors every several minutes. There are also big colorful balls to kick around. They change colors with every kick. The are pretty big, about the size of a regular sized child.


At the very end of the park, is the coolest thing yet, a color and water show! Listen carefully for the music to play and run straight over so you don’t miss it! The small pond has several lights inside and water jets for a show. As the music plays, the water dances. Words cannot even describe how amazing this show is. The water shoots up higher than the nearest tower and there are even water explosions. Water twists upwards, fans out, and explodes in between dancing to the music. It is not to be missed!

But if that isn’t enough lights for one night, be sure to walk through the tunnels of light. They change colors as you walk or run through them. Some kids kick a ball through them and play soccer to watch the colors change with the passing of objects through them. On your way home, be sure to stop by to see Santa at Santa’s Workshop in the mall! Lite Brite Night is only on Thursdays from 6-8pm.
